Ukraine releases video evidence of latest drone strikes on Russian military targets
Ukraine has released footage documenting recent drone strikes against Russian military assets, including a Neva radar system, Pantsir air defense unit, and a tugboat. The video evidence showcases Ukraine's ongoing use of unmanned systems to target Russian military infrastructure and equipment.
The released footage provides visual confirmation of successful strikes against key Russian military capabilities. The Neva radar system and Pantsir air defense complexes are significant components of Russian air defense networks, while the targeting of transport assets like the tugboat reflects Ukraine's broader strategy to disrupt Russian logistics and supply operations. Ukraine has consistently used drone strikes as a primary tool in asymmetric warfare, targeting both frontline military positions and rear-area infrastructure to degrade Russian operational capability.

Public release of drone strike videos serves as both evidence of Ukrainian military effectiveness and a demonstration of the evolving nature of modern warfare. Such documentation highlights how Ukraine is leveraging drone technology to counter Russian military advantages in conventional forces.
